Establish a Positive Way Of Thinking



To make certain an effective initial dental visit for your child, it's important to develop a favorable way of thinking. Begin by speaking to your youngster about the go to in a tranquil and comforting fashion. Stress that checking out the dentist is a typical part of taking care of their teeth which the dental expert exists to help keep their smile healthy. Avoid using unfavorable words or expressions that may produce anxiety or stress and anxiety.

Rather, focus on the positive elements, such as reaching see awesome dental devices or obtaining a sticker label or toy at the end of the check out. Urge your youngster to ask inquiries and share any concerns they might have.

Familiarize Your Kid With the Dental Office



Start by taking your child to the oral workplace before their first see, so they can come to be accustomed to the surroundings and feel even more secure. This step is critical in helping to minimize any type of stress and anxiety or fear your kid may have about mosting likely to the dental expert.

Here are a few methods to familiarize your child with the oral office:

- ** Role-play at home **: Act to be the dental practitioner and have your kid sit in a chair while you analyze their teeth. This will certainly help them comprehend what to anticipate throughout their actual check out.

- ** Review publications or view video clips **: Try to find children's publications or videos that explain what happens at the dental professional. This can help your child feel a lot more comfy and ready.

Equip Your Child With Healthy Dental Routines



Establishing healthy dental practices is necessary for your child's oral health and wellness and total health. By showing your child excellent dental practices from a very early age, you can help prevent tooth decay, gum illness, and other dental wellness problems.

Begin by instructing them the importance of brushing their teeth twice a day, making use of a soft-bristled tooth brush and fluoride toothpaste. Show them the proper cleaning technique, making sure they brush all surface areas of their teeth and gum tissues.

Urge them to floss daily to remove plaque and food particles from between their teeth.

Restriction their intake of sweet treats and beverages, as these can add to dental cavity.

Ultimately, routine normal oral exams for your youngster to keep their dental health and resolve any concerns early.
